In a new sample of the violence that has bled Mexico for years, the authorities reported the sinister discovery of 19 bodies in different parts of the town of Uruapan, Michoacán. According to the prosecution, nine bodies were hung pedestrian bridges, another seven were dismembered and the remaining three hidden in bags.

Local media indicated that a narcomanta call signed by the Jalisco New Generation Cartel (CJNG) was found with the bodies. "Make homeland and kill a viagra", the message allegedly read, referring to the Viagra poster.

The massacre that ended 19 lives, including those of several women, seems to be another episode in the endless war of drug cartels for control of territory.

"Certain criminal groups are fighting over the territory, for the control of the production, distribution and consumption of drugs," said Michoacán's attorney general, Adrián López Solís, in statements collected by the media. "Unfortunately, this conflict is a type of act that just alarms the public."

According to security analyst Alejandro Hope, this type of macabre act is intended to send a message to the authorities.

"This type of public act, of dramatic violence, when you not only kill but brag about the murders, is meant to intimidate rivals and send a message to the authorities," Hope told the New York Post. "This type of cynical impunity has been increasing in Michoacán."

Murders have increased 5.3 percent in Mexico in the first six months of the year, compared to the same period in 2018, the year in which 35,964 homicides were recorded, according to figures cited by the media.
